Recently, guests were bamboozled into thinking they were meeting Matt Damon in World Showcase at Epcot. A man who some may debate as being a Matt Damon lookalike was parading around World Showcase wearing a tank top emblazoned with Matt Damon’s face on it.
Red flag: a celebrity wearing a shirt with their face plastered all over it. I highly doubt most celebrities would walk around World Showcase with a tank top with their face on it, overtly looking for attention. Many times when celebrities are out in public, they attempt to be as incognito as possible often wearing hats and sunglasses to disguise themselves.
This self-proclaimed Matt Damon lookalike was taking photos with guests who truly believed he was Matt Damon. If you look closely, it is obviously not Matt Damon.
